A Beautiful Florida Coastal Cottage that has been complelely renovated in the most sought after neighborhood of Elliott Point. This is not your typical quick flip house. This concrete block home was completely gutted and built back new with many upgrades and extras. To start, there is a metal roof and upgraded spray foam insulation. The exterior features a hardie cement board siding on top of solid concrete block. Then, ALL the windows are hurricane impact windows meaning no hurricane shutters are needed! This home has also been fully re-wired and re-plumbed with PEX plumbing. There is a new tankless gas water heater & a new HVAC. The exterior also has a brand new lawn pump, timer and irrigation system and has been professionally soded and landscaped. The all new interior has a lovely LVP driftwood plank flooring throughout. The brand new kitchen has white shaker cabinets and light granite counters with all new appliances and a nice breakfast bar counter. The master bathroom features a frameless glass subway tiled shower, marble mosaic flooring and a nice spacious vanity. There is white wood shiplap on the walls of both bathrooms adding to that coastal look. The hall bathroom has a nice tub/shower combo with subway tile. This 3/2 home on a 1/4 acre lot is the perfect little cottage in the heart of Elliott Point. Every updated detail of this property was carefully selected and quality crafted.This ideal lot backs up to a quiet section of Ferry Park and the wooded back make the backyard feel extra large & private. Enjoy a short walk to the Choctawhatchee Bay for sunset bird-watching or dolphin sightings. The Shoppes at Paradise Point and Uptown Station Plaza are less than a mile away, as well as charming Downtown Fort Walton Beach where you will enjoy outdoor markets, waterfront parks, festivals, parades, and a handful of pubs, eateries and live music venues. The neighborhood is fantastic! It's so close to shopping, entertainment, parks, the beach, and the many water access points to the bay. It's not uncommon to see neighbors walking, working out, driving in golf carts, or cruising on their beach bikes. There is a terrific neighborhood app that helps keep everyone connected and it's also in a great school district. The elementary school is just 2 blocks away. And, although the home feels modern and fresh with all the renovations, it still has the whimsical charm of a mid-century modern beach retreat. The gigantic Southern live oak trees in the backyard are gorgeous and they are also scattered throughout the neighborhood. They are one of the many natural delights which help give historic Elliott Point the southern charm and familiar beauty you will enjoy every day.

R-1
Residential Single-family Low Density District
The low density residential zoning district is established to provide for single-family homes in traditional residential neighborhoods. The R-1 zoning district is limited to single-family homes and accessory structures customarily associated with residential development. Accessory dwelling units may be permissible when standards for such uses can be met, including lot sizes and compatibility standards.
